An electric valve operates by using an electric motor to actuate a valve mechanism. When an electrical signal is received, the actuator opens or closes the valve, allowing or blocking fluid flow. The actuation can be either linear or rotary, depending on the type of valve being used. This precise control is essential for maintaining desired pressure levels, flow rates, and temperatures in various systems.
A natural gas pressure regulator is a device that reduces and stabilizes the pressure of natural gas before it enters a pipeline or a gas appliance. Without these regulators, the high pressure from gas supply lines could cause damage to appliances or create unsafe conditions. Regulators are essential in both residential and commercial settings, ensuring that the gas delivered is at the appropriate pressure for various applications.
A gas separator filter is a device engineered to remove impurities such as moisture, dust, and other particulates from gas streams. These impurities can lead to operational inefficiencies, equipment damage, and reduced product quality if not adequately managed. By utilizing these filters, industries can enhance the reliability and safety of their operations, protecting both equipment and personnel.

- Pressure relief valves come in different types and configurations, depending on the specific requirements of the system they are installed in. The most common types include spring-loaded, pilot-operated, and rupture disc valves. Spring-loaded valves use a spring mechanism to regulate pressure, while pilot-operated valves use a separate control system to sense pressure changes and open the valve as needed. Rupture disc valves, on the other hand, have a thin membrane that ruptures at a pre-determined pressure, releasing the excess pressure.. - Solenoid valves are another popular choice for gas safety applications. These valves rely on an electric current to keep them open, and when that current is interrupted, the valve closes automatically. Solenoid valves are often used in conjunction with electronic control systems to provide an additional layer of safety and control.
To maintain the effectiveness of safety relief valves, operators must adhere to manufacturer guidelines and industry standards. Regular inspections involve checking for signs of wear, corrosion, and proper seating of the valve. It is also important to test the valve periodically to ensure that it opens at the correct set pressure. Any valve that fails to open or does not close properly should be replaced or repaired immediately.

Accurate gas metering is crucial not only for billing purposes but also for safety. Gas leaks can pose serious risks to life and property. Regular monitoring and reporting through gas metering systems help identify abnormal consumption patterns that may indicate a leak or other issues. Utility companies often implement monitoring systems that provide alerts for unusual consumption changes, allowing for prompt investigation and resolution.

- Natural gas is predominantly composed of methane, a simple hydrocarbon compound consisting of one carbon atom and four hydrogen atoms. It is formed deep beneath the Earth's surface through the decomposition of organic matter over millions of years. The gas is then extracted from underground reservoirs through drilling and hydraulic fracturing, also known as fracking.
1. Gate Valve This type is ideal for applications where a straight-line flow of fluid is required. Gate valves provide minimal flow resistance and are used primarily for on/off control rather than throttling. They are not suitable for regulating flow due to their design, which can cause erosion if partially opened.

- Filter separators work on the principle of separating contaminants from fluids by passing them through a filter media. The filter media can be made of various materials, such as activated carbon, cellulose, or polyester, depending on the application and type of contaminants to be removed. The contaminants are trapped on the surface of the filter media, while the clean fluid passes through.
